Lets compare vitamin content per 1 kilogram of Canned Orange Juice vs Cooked Millet:
- 1 kilogram of Canned Orange Juice has 1.3 times more Vitamin B9 and more Vitamin C than Cooked Millet.
- While 1 kg of Cooked Millet contains 2.7 times more Vitamin B1, 3.9 times more Vitamin B2, 6.6 times more Vitamin B3 and 3.5 times more Vitamin B6 than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ice.
- Both Canned Orange Juice and Cooked Millet provide similar amounts of Vitamin B5 per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Canned Orange Juice have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B2 and Vitamin B3
- 1 kilogram of Cooked Millet have insufficient amounts of Vitamin C
- Both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ice as well as Cooked Millet have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in D, Vitamin E and Vitamin K in one kilogram.
Comparing minerals per 1 kilogram for Canned Orange Juice vs Cooked Millet:
- 1 kilogram of Canned Orange Juice has 3 times more Potassium and 1.2 times more Water than Cooked Millet.
- While 1 kg of Cooked Millet contains 7.3 times more Copper, 6.3 times more Iron, 4.4 times more Magnesium, 13 times more Manganese, 5.9 times more Phosphorus and 22.8 times more Zinc than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ice.
- 1 kilogram of Canned Orange Juice lack sufficient amounts of Iron, Manganese and Zinc
- 1 kilogram of Cooked Millet lack sufficient amounts of Potassium
- Both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ice as well as Cooked Millet lack sufficient amounts of Calcium and Selenium in one kilogram.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 kilogram:
- 1 kilogram of Canned Orange Juice has 67.4 times more Sugars than Cooked Millet.
- While 1 kg of Cooked Millet contains 2.5 times more Energy, 17.8 times more Omega 6, 2.1 times more Carbohydrate, 4.3 times more Fiber and 5.2 times more Protein than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ice.
- 1 kilogram of Canned Orange Juice provide inadequate amounts of Energy, Omega 6, Fiber and Protein
- Both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ice as well as Cooked Millet prov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 in one kilogram.
